According to the construction plan, Hung Yen Provincial General Hospital has a modern architectural space, invested in facilities and advanced technology equipment. The hospital is planned to be built in Pho Hien ward, divided into 3 sub-areas, including: medical examination and emergency block; inpatient block; technical and emergency resuscitation block with a scale of 1,500 beds.
At the meeting, delegates discussed the architectural plan; hospital location; project implementation time and progress.
Speaking at the meeting, Mr. Pham Quang Ngoc - Chairman of Hung Yen Provincial People's Committee - emphasized the role and significance of deploying the construction of the Provincial General Hospital with a scale of 1,500 beds. In addition, suggesting the architectural design plan of the Hospital in a modern direction, but it is necessary to preserve the unique identity of the area, in harmony with the urban architectural plan of Pho Hien.
The Chairman of the Provincial People's Committee affirmed that the province is determined to make the project implemented and put into operation soon. Requesting the consulting and design unit to plan the construction area of the Provincial General Hospital into a medical center complex of Hung Yen province, aiming to become a medical center of the Red River Delta region. The Department of Construction coordinates with the Department of Health and relevant departments, branches, and units to fully prepare the conditions for the project to be started in 2026.
